Art enthusiasts shouldn’t miss a visit to the renowned Golden Triangle of Art. This triangle is comprised of three world-class museums – the Prado Museum, the Reina Sofia Museum, and the Thyssen-Bornemisza Museum. The Prado Museum, one of the most important art institutions in the world, houses an extensive collection of Spanish masterpieces, including works by Diego Velazquez and Francisco Goya. The Reina Sofia Museum, on the other hand, showcases contemporary art, including Picasso’s iconic painting, “Guernica.” Lastly, the Thyssen-Bornemisza Museum exhibits an eclectic collection spanning from medieval to modern art, satisfying all art enthusiasts’ tastes.

If you are a food lover, Madrid is a paradise for your taste buds. Indulge in the city’s famous culinary delights, such as the traditional Spanish dish, paella, or the popular tapas. Take a stroll through the Mercado de San Miguel, a vibrant food market filled with local vendors offering an array of mouthwatering delicacies. Sample Spanish olives, cured meats, and delicious seafood while sipping on a glass of locally produced wine or a refreshing sangria.

When it comes to shopping, Madrid offers a myriad of options for all budgets and tastes. The Gran Via, the city’s main shopping street, is lined with international brands and high-street stores. For a more unique and local experience, head to the neighborhood of Chueca, known for its independent boutiques and trendy shops. Explore its quirky streets and discover one-of-a-kind fashion items, handmade jewelry, and local designer pieces.

Nature lovers can also find solace in Madrid’s lush green spaces. The Retiro Park, located in the heart of the city, is a peaceful oasis where you can relax, go for a leisurely stroll, or rent a boat and row on the park’s beautiful lake.
